Liverpool could 'blow Brighton out of the water' with contract offer for Jude Bellingham alternative

They are prepared to break the bank.

Liverpool are reportedly preparing a huge contract offer for Brighton midfielder Alexis Mac Allister, amid interest from Premier league rivals Manchester United.

The countdown to the transfer window is on and no one is more ready than Jurgen Klopp, who is is in the market for midfield recruits this summer.

Jude Bellingham has been one of the many names rumoured with a move to Anfield. However, the Reds were forced to put a pin in their pursuit of the 19-year-old due to the extortionate transfer fees involved.

The Merseyside club must now look elsewhere, and Brighton midfielder Mac Allister has emerged as a potential alternative.

Worryingly for Seagulls supporters, the club may find it hard to keep hold of the Argentinian midfielder, with Liverpool and Manchester United allegedly planning to offer Mac Allister a mega-deal.

Liverpool plotting move for Mac Allister

Brighton are aware of growing interest surrounding Mac Allister, who has been earmarked by several top Premier League clubs including Liverpool, Manchester United and Chelsea, claim Football Insider.

The report states that Brighton are likely to be “blown out of the water” by the the three clubs when it comes down to the personal terms of Mac Allister's contract.

The 24-year-old playmaker is already among the highest earners at the Amex with a reported wage of £50,000-a-week. Meanwhile, his contract is not due to expire until June 2025.

However, it is thought that Mac Allister is eager to play at a higher level and would struggle to refuse a move to a top club this summer.

The Argentina international has managed ten goals and two assists in 29 appearances across all competitions this season.

While he started all but one game for his country in Qatar, playing a key role in Argentina's path to the final, where they went on to lift the World Cup trophy.
